On 04/25/2018 05:40 PM, wenxi...@linux.vnet.ibm.com wrote:
> From: Wen Xiong <wenxi...@linux.vnet.ibm.com>
> 
> This patch adds new adapter error log for P9 system with the new
> AZ SAS cable.
> ---
>  drivers/scsi/ipr.c |    2 ++
>  1 files changed, 2 insertions(+), 0 deletions(-)
> 
> diff --git a/drivers/scsi/ipr.c b/drivers/scsi/ipr.c
> index dda1a64..6615ad8 100644
> --- a/drivers/scsi/ipr.c
> +++ b/drivers/scsi/ipr.c
> @@ -435,6 +435,8 @@ struct ipr_error_table_t ipr_error_table[] = {
>       "4080: IOA exceeded maximum operating temperature"},
>       {0x060B8000, 0, IPR_DEFAULT_LOG_LEVEL,
>       "4085: Service required"},
> +     {0x060B8100, 0, IPR_DEFAULT_LOG_LEVEL,
> +     "4086: SAS Adapter Hardware Configuration Error"},
>       {0x06288000, 0, IPR_DEFAULT_LOG_LEVEL,
>       "3140: Device bus not ready to ready transition"},
>       {0x06290000, 0, IPR_DEFAULT_LOG_LEVEL,
>
